Home
last modified time | relevance | path

Searched refs:isCanonicalDecl (Results 1 – 8 of 8) sorted by relevance

/freebsd-9-stable/contrib/llvm/tools/clang/lib/Serialization/
DASTWriterDecl.cpp390 if (D->isCanonicalDecl()) { in VisitFunctionDecl()
1008 if (D->isCanonicalDecl()) { in VisitCXXMethodDecl()
1134 assert(I->isCanonicalDecl() && "Expected only canonical decls in set"); in VisitClassTemplateDecl()
1143 assert(I->isCanonicalDecl() && "Expected only canonical decls in set"); in VisitClassTemplateDecl()
1170 Record.push_back(D->isCanonicalDecl()); in VisitClassTemplateSpecializationDecl()
1172 if (D->isCanonicalDecl()) { in VisitClassTemplateSpecializationDecl()
1212 assert(I->isCanonicalDecl() && "Expected only canonical decls in set"); in VisitVarTemplateDecl()
1222 assert(I->isCanonicalDecl() && "Expected only canonical decls in set"); in VisitVarTemplateDecl()
1253 Record.push_back(D->isCanonicalDecl()); in VisitVarTemplateSpecializationDecl()
1255 if (D->isCanonicalDecl()) { in VisitVarTemplateSpecializationDecl()
[all …]
DASTReaderDecl.cpp629 if (FD->isCanonicalDecl()) { // if canonical add to template's set. in VisitFunctionDecl()
1566 if (D->isCanonicalDecl()) { // It's kept in the folding set. in VisitClassTemplateSpecializationDeclImpl()
1702 if (D->isCanonicalDecl()) { // It's kept in the folding set. in VisitVarTemplateSpecializationDeclImpl()
/freebsd-9-stable/contrib/llvm/tools/clang/lib/AST/
DDeclTemplate.cpp366 assert(Existing->isCanonicalDecl() && "Non-canonical specialization?"); in AddSpecialization()
389 assert(Existing->isCanonicalDecl() && "Non-canonical specialization?"); in AddPartialSpecialization()
1034 assert(Existing->isCanonicalDecl() && "Non-canonical specialization?"); in AddSpecialization()
1055 assert(Existing->isCanonicalDecl() && "Non-canonical specialization?"); in AddPartialSpecialization()
DDeclCXX.cpp1505 assert(MD->isCanonicalDecl() && "Method is not canonical!"); in addOverriddenMethod()
DASTContext.cpp1209 assert(Method->isCanonicalDecl() && Overridden->isCanonicalDecl()); in addOverriddenMethod()
/freebsd-9-stable/contrib/llvm/tools/clang/lib/Sema/
DIdentifierResolver.cpp283 if (RD->isCanonicalDecl()) in compareDeclarations()
DSemaDecl.cpp7608 Method->isCanonicalDecl()) { in CheckFunctionDeclaration()
9787 if (getLangOpts().MicrosoftExt && FD->isPure() && FD->isCanonicalDecl()) in ActOnFinishFunctionBody()
/freebsd-9-stable/contrib/llvm/tools/clang/include/clang/AST/
DDeclBase.h712 bool isCanonicalDecl() const { return getCanonicalDecl() == this; } in isCanonicalDecl() function